Subject: [PATCH 02/10] riscv: dts: sophgo: cv18xx: Split into CPU core and peripheral parts
Date: Sun,  9 Feb 2025 23:06:27 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20250209220646.1090868-3-alexander.sverdlin@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20250209220646.1090868-1-alexander.sverdlin@gmail.com>

Make the peripheral device tree re-usable on ARM64 platform by splitting it
into CPU-core specific and peripheral parts.

Add SOC_PERIPHERAL_IRQ() macro which explicitly maps peripheral nubering
into "plic" interrupt-controller numbering.

 ar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v181x.dtsi        |   2 +-
 ar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v18xx-periph.dtsi | 313 ++++++++++++++++++
 ar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v18xx.dtsi        | 305 +----------------
 3 files changed, 317 insertions(+), 303 deletions(-)
 create mode 100644 ar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v18xx-periph.dtsi

diff --git a/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v181x.dtsi b/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v181x.dtsi
index 5fd14dd1b14f..bbdb30653e9a 100644
--- a/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v181x.dtsi
+++ b/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v181x.dtsi
@@ -11,7 +11,7 @@ soc {
 		emmc: mmc@4300000 {
 			compatible = "sophgo,cv1800b-dwcmshc";
 			reg = <0x4300000 0x1000>;
-			interrupts = <34 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+			interrupts = <SOC_PERIPHERAL_IRQ(18) I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
 			clocks = <&clk CLK_AXI4_EMMC>,
 				 <&clk CLK_EMMC>;
 			clock-names = "core", "bus";

diff --git a/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v18xx.dtsi b/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v18xx.dtsi
index c18822ec849f..57a01b71aa67 100644
--- a/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v18xx.dtsi
+++ b/arch/riscv/boot/dts/sophgo/cv18xx.dtsi
@@ -4,9 +4,9 @@
  * Copyright (C) 2023 Inochi Amaoto <inochiama@outlook.com>
  */
 
-#include <dt-bindings/clock/sophgo,cv1800.h>
-#include <dt-bindings/gpio/gpio.h>
-#include <dt-bindings/interrupt-controller/irq.h>
+#define SOC_PERIPHERAL_IRQ(nr)		((nr) + 16)
+
+#include "cv18xx-periph.dtsi"
 
 / {
 	#address-cells = <1>;
@@ -41,310 +41,11 @@ cpu0_intc: interrupt-controller {
 		};
 	};
